At its core, Phenyl Dichlorophosphate is characterized by the presence of a phenyl group attached to a phosphoryl dichloride moiety (C6H5OPOCl2). This structure imbues it with notable reactivity, particularly the two highly reactive chlorine atoms and the phenolic oxygen group. Typically appearing as a colorless to pale yellow corrosive liquid at room temperature, it is sensitive to moisture, readily undergoing hydrolysis to release hydrogen chloride gas. This inherent reactivity makes it an exceptional phosphorylating agent and dehydrating agent in organic synthesis. The synthesis of Phenyl Dichlorophosphate commonly involves the reaction of phenol with phosphorus oxychloride (POCl3). A typical industrial process might involve adding phenol dropwise to phosphorus oxychloride under controlled temperature conditions, often in the presence of a catalyst. Following the reaction, excess phosphorus oxychloride is distilled off, and the product is further purified through vacuum distillation. This meticulous process ensures the high purity (often ≥99%) required for its demanding applications, such as in the pharmaceutical sector. The diverse applications of Phenyl Dichlorophosphate stem directly from its chemical properties. It is indispensable in the phosphorylation of nucleotides, amino acids, and alcohols, playing a vital role in the creation of complex organic molecules. Its utility extends to being a precursor for pesticides, flame retardants, and vital drug intermediates.
